missingWrote a review on 05 Feb
The room was comfortable with a king size bed two tables and two chairs (although we would have been courting death to sit on one of them as it wobbled alarmingly!). The room was large enough and the shower room reasonable with sink/toilet/bidet. The bed linen was changed during our 5 day stay as were the towels.
Dodgy knees and dicky tickers - forget it. The lift is only for residents of the building and not for hotel guests. The reception is in the 1st floor (2nd if you are American) and the accommodation is on the 3rd floor (4th USA). If you have some weighty luggage you may have a problem. The reception does not have any of the usual tourist information you might expect. Being on a main thoroughfare and near to the forum (@ 300 metres) there is a fair bit of noise throughout the night and the windows do little to obscure this but if you remember to bring your earplugs you will not have a problem.
